Durability

Window hinges are a crucial part of the overall functionality and longevity of windows. Quality window hinges are able to endure the elements and also prevent windows from closing unexpectedly. This could be dangerous for pets or children. They also regulate airflow, keep the interior cool and reduce the energy costs. If your window hinges are damaged or worn out, it is a good idea for you to replace them as soon as possible. This simple DIY project will help you save money on repair costs and increase the durability of windows.

The material that they are constructed from is a major element in their longevity. Hinges made of durable materials such as brass, stainless steel, or zinc-aluminum alloys resist wear, corrosion and extreme weather conditions. They can also hold windows with heavier sashes, which lessens the stress on the hinges.

The design of hinges, as well as the material used can contribute to their the durability. Hinges with multiple bearing points spread the weight of the sash equally to prevent premature wear and tear. Hinges that have adjustable tension permit you to alter the amount of pressure that is applied to the sash.

Energy efficiency

The quality of hinges is a major element in determining how energy efficient a window will be. The quality of hinges can determine whether or not they create gaps in between the frame and the sash. This can allow warm air to escape in winter and cold to enter during the summer. This results in more expensive energy bills. Windows hinges that are properly installed and matched make sure that windows are sealed tightly. This can reduce energy consumption and minimizes air flow.

The efficiency of sash window hinges is dependent on their materials, design, and performance. Brass, stainless steel, and aluminum hinges are the most popular options due to their long-lasting properties and their ability to endure prolonged use. They are also light and have a sleek look. These materials are susceptible to rust, particularly in damp conditions. It is crucial to select a durable hinge designed to stand up to different weather conditions and climates.

Awning windows require specialized hinges to ensure they stay open in the desired position. Friction hinges, made up of two interconnected plates one of which is attached to the frame and the second fixed to the sash are a preferred option for this kind of window because they offer the highest stability and can keep the window in position at any angle. They are also ideal for regions with windy conditions, as they permit the sash to remain firmly in place even when the window has been fully opened.

Hinges with thermal breaks or insulating materials minimize the transfer of heat through them. This decreases thermal bridging, which occurs when heat bypasses the insulation and transfers through the hinge mechanism. The resulting reduction in air leakage and drafts helps maintain an even temperature inside and improves comfort for the occupants and decreases cooling and heating costs.
